@charset "utf-8";

/* CSS Document */

body{padding:0px; margin:0px; font-size:12px; font-family:Tahoma, Arial;}
#wrapper{margin:0px auto; width:970px;}
#container{width:920px; margin:0px auto;}
#contleft{width:150px; float:left;}
#contleft h1{background:url(../images/categorybg.gif) no-repeat; margin:0px; padding:0px; width:150px; height:29px; font-family:Arial, Helvetica, sans-serif; font-size:15px; color:#FFFFFF; text-align:center;}
#contleft p{margin:0px; padding:0px;}
#contright{width:760px; margin-left:10px; float:right;}
#contright h1{padding:0px; padding-bottom:10px; font-family:Arial, Helvetica, sans-serif; font-size:25px; margin:0px;}
.fleft{float:left;}
.fright{float:right;}
.clear{clear:both;}
.cls{clear:both; background:url(../images/spacer.gif) repeat-x; width:100%; height:1px;}
.cls1{clear:both; background:url(../images/spacer.gif) repeat-x; width:100%; height:10px;}
.cls2{clear:both; background:url(../images/spacer.gif) repeat-x; width:100%; height:15px;}
.spacer{clear:both; background:url(../images/spacer.gif) repeat-x; width:100%; height:20px;}
.spacer1{clear:both; background:url(../images/spacer.gif) repeat-x; width:100%; height:40px;}
.logo{background:url(../images/logo.gif) no-repeat 20px 0px; width:250px; height:120px;}
.secure{background:url(../images/secure.png) no-repeat 0px 40px; width:240px; line-height:130px; height:130px;}
.satisfaction{background:url(../images/satisfaction.png) no-repeat 10px 0px; width:130px; height:130px;}
.shipping{background:url(../images/quickship.png) no-repeat 0px 10px; width:120px; height:130px;}
.ez{background:url(../images/ez.png) no-repeat; width:135px; margin:0px auto;  height:150px;}
.privacy{background:url(../images/privacy.png) no-repeat; width:135px; margin:0px auto;  height:156px;}
.save{background:url(../images/save50.png) no-repeat; margin:0px auto; width:160px; height:141px;}
.topbg{background:url(../images/top-grad-bg.gif) no-repeat; height:38px; width:970px;}
.bg{background:url(../images/grad-bg.gif) repeat-y; width:970px;}
.padL{padding-left:100px;}
.padT{padding-top:4px;}
.padT10{padding-top:10px;}
.btbg{background:url(../images/bottom-grad-bg.gif) no-repeat; height:38px; width:970px;}
.pad{padding:7px 10px 5px 10px;}
.pad10{padding:10px;}
.navL{background:url(../images/navL.gif) no-repeat; height:50px; width:14px;}
.navR{background:url(../images/navR.gif) no-repeat; height:50px; width:14px;}
.navbg{background:url(../images/navbg.gif) repeat-x; height:50px; font-size:14px; font-weight:bold; color:#FFFFFF;}
.sep{background:url(../images/sep.gif) no-repeat;}
#main-nav{float:left; width:892px; margin:0px; padding:0px; height:50px;}
#main-nav ul{list-style-type:none; margin:0px; padding:5px 0px 0px 0px;}
#main-nav ul li{float:left; display:inline; padding-right:10px; padding-left:10px; line-height:32px;}
a{text-decoration:none;color:#FFFFFF;}
a:link{text-decoration:none;color:#FFFFFF;}
a:visited{text-decoration:none;color:#FFFFFF;}
a:hover{text-decoration:underline; color:#FFFFFF;}
.bdr{border:2px solid #dadada; border-top:none;}
.bdr1{border:2px solid #dadada;}
a.lnav{color:#db2bb6; text-decoration:none; border-bottom:1px solid #db2bb6; line-height:25px; font-weight:normal; font-size:14px;}
a.lnav:link{color:#db2bb6; text-decoration:none; font-weight:normal; font-size:14px; border-bottom:1px solid #db2bb6; line-height:25px;}
a.lnav:visited{color:#db2bb6; text-decoration:none; font-weight:normal; font-size:14px;border-bottom:1px solid #db2bb6; line-height:25px;}
a.lnav:hover{color:#a35583; text-decoration:none; font-weight:normal; font-size:14px; border-bottom:none; line-height:25px;}
.red{color:#e33361;}
.font11{font-size:11px;}
.font17{font-size:17px; font-weight:bold;}
.dgry{color:#383838;}
.gry{color:#6e6e6e;}
.frame{background:url(../images/product-frame.gif) no-repeat 0px 0px; margin:0px; width:215px; height:100px; !height:105px; _height:105px; padding:6px 7px 7px 7px; !padding:6px 7px 0px 7px; _padding:6px 7px 0px 7px;}
#footer{border-top:2px solid #ffcfec; margin-bottom:20px;}
.footer{font-size:14px; font-weight:bold; color:#d42b8f;}
a.footer{font-size:14px; font-weight:bold; color:#d42b8f;}
a.footer:link{font-size:14px; font-weight:bold; color:#d42b8f; text-decoration:underline;}
a.footer:visited{font-size:14px; font-weight:bold; color:#d42b8f; text-decoration:underline;}
a.footer:hover{font-size:14px; font-weight:bold; color:#d42b8f; text-decoration:none;}